Auction 38: Fine Ancient Artifacts

Our March 8th auction will be filled with over 450 lots of fine museum-quality items. This auction offers a spectacular selection of authentic, museum quality, and well-provenanced Ancient Egyptian, Greek, Roman, Pre-columbian, Near Eastern, Islamic, Byzantine, and Ethnographic antiquities.

A Cypriot terracotta figure of a warrior: A Cypriot terracotta figure of a warrior, c. 750 - 480 BC, holding circular shield and pointed helmet, his feet are together with the ends of his feet or shoes pointing upward. H: 6 in (15.2 cm).

A Roman marble head of a lady: A Roman marble head of a lady, c. 1st Century AD, with pouty features and hair pulled back into a bun at the nape of her neck. H: 2 in (5.1 cm). Light weathering, some strengthening of the details.
